What Is a Crypto Casino?A crypto Casino Crypto Coin is an online gaming website that accepts cryptocurrency-- such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in, or stablecoins-- as a primary type of payment. Unlike traditional online casinos that depend on fiat currencies and centralized payment processors, a crypto casino leverages blockchain innovation to assist in deposits, wagers, and withdrawals. A lot of these platforms also host games whose outcomes are proven on the blockchain, including a layer of openness that traditional operators often lack. How a Crypto Casino WorksAccount Creation-- Players sign up by creating a username and password, frequently without any personal data required (a practice called "KYC‑free" registration). Wallet Integration-- The platform provides a distinct wallet address or incorporates with external Best Crypto Casino wallets (e.g., MetaMask). Players move funds from their personal wallet to the casino's hot or cold wallet. Bet Placement-- Games are provided in 2 primary formats: Provably Fair Games-- Cryptographic algorithms let players confirm each hand or spin's fairness. Traditional RNG Games-- Standard random number generators are utilized, however the platform still settling in crypto.Payouts-- Winnings are credited to the gamer's on‑site wallet and can be withdrawn straight to a blockchain address. Transaction speeds depend upon the network's blockage and the picked cryptocurrency.Advantages of Using Cryptocurrency at Online CasinosLower Transaction Fees-- Crypto deals bypass intermediary banks, often leading to very little or absolutely no costs. Faster Withdrawals-- Withdrawals can be processed within minutes, specifically when utilizing networks like Bitcoin's Lightning or Ethereum's Layer‑2 solutions. Improved Privacy-- Players can bet without exposing credit‑card details or individuality, attracting those looking for discretion. International Accessibility-- Cryptocurrencies are not bound by national borders, allowing users from areas with restrictive betting laws to participate (offered they comply with local guidelines). Provable Fairness-- Blockchain‑based video games give gamers the capability to audit the randomness of results, promoting trust.Threats and ChallengesVolatility-- The value of a player's bankroll can swing drastically due to cryptocurrency price changes. Regulatory Uncertainty-- Many jurisdictions still do not have clear legislation on crypto betting, leaving operators and gamers in a legal grey area. Security Threats-- While blockchain itself is safe, exchange hacks, phishing rip-offs, and improperly secured hot wallets have resulted in losses. Limited Customer Support-- Some crypto casinos run with minimal personnel, making dispute resolution Slow. Security and FairnessTwo-element authentication (2FA)-- Most reliable crypto casinos require 2FA for withdrawals. Freezer-- Funds are kept in offline cold wallets to alleviate hacking risk. Provably Fair Algorithms-- Players can validate video game hashes using publicly readily available tools. Third‑Party Audits-- Independent screening firms (e.g., eCOGRA, iTech Labs) frequently audit RNGs and payment percentages.Future OutlookThe merging of blockchain and online gambling suggests a developing market. Emerging trends consist of: Layer‑2 Scaling Solutions-- Adoption of Ethereum's Optimism and Bitcoin's Lightning Network will further speed up deals. NFT‑based Games-- Non‑fungible tokens are being incorporated for special in‑game possessions and reward systems. Decentralized Autonomous Casinos (DACs)-- Fully on‑chain gambling establishments promise complete openness and neighborhood governance, decreasing the need for a central operator.While regulative clearness will be the most significant catalyst, the growing mainstream approval of cryptocurrency suggests that crypto casinos will continue to record a larger share of the worldwide iGaming market.
